THE NEW WORLD OFANTI-THEFT TECHNOLOGYThis Toyota vehicle may be equipped withan electronic “immobilizer” anti-theftsystem. When the key is inserted into theignition switch it transmits an electroniccode to an immobilizer computer. Theengine will only start if the code in the keymatches the code in the immobilizer. If thecode does not match, the immobilizerdisables the ignition and fuel systems.While an exact physical copy of the keywill open the door and allow retrieval ofitems locked in the vehicle, it won’t startthe vehicle unless the key has the samecode as the immobilizer.

SECURITYFor security purposes, access to keycodes and service procedures forelectronically registering replacement keysis restricted. Only a Toyota dealer orcertain bonded/registered independentlocksmiths can generate replacement keys.

REPLACING THE KEYUpon purchase, each vehicle should havetwo master keys and an aluminum tagwith a key-code imprinted on it.

To generate a fully functional replacementkey (one that will both open the doors andstart the engine), one of the master keysis required. To make a key that will openthe door for retrieval of items lockedinside the vehicle, the aluminum key-codetag can be used. If a master key or thealuminum key-code tag is not available, aToyota dealer or certain registeredlocksmiths can obtain the key code from arestricted-access database. Thesebusinesses can also access a serviceutility to reprogram the immobilizer if allregistered master keys have been lost. If aToyota dealer is not available, please referto www.aloa.org to find abonded/registered locksmith who performshigh security key service.

KEEPING THE KEY SAFEReplacing an immobilizer key may becostly. It is advisable to keep a sparemaster key and the aluminum key-codetag in a safe place. If you record thekey-code in more than one place, do notrecord it in a way that can be easilyidentified and associated with the vehicle.It is wise to keep a copy of the key-codeoutside of the vehicle.

If the vehicle was delivered with less thantwo keys and the aluminum key-code tag,consider having the Toyota dealer or aqualified independent automotivelocksmith make a duplicate key before youneed it.

Under this policy, you are eligible fortransportation assistance if your Toyotamust be kept overnight forwarranty-covered repairs. The policyapplies when your vehicle must be keptovernight for any of the following reasons:

• The warranty repairs will take longerthan one day to complete.

• The warrantable condition requiresextensive diagnosis.

• The parts needed for the warrantyrepairs are not readily available andyour vehicle is inoperative or unsafe todrive.

The policy does not apply when warrantyrepairs can be completed in one day butthe vehicle must be kept overnight due todealer or owner scheduling conflicts.

The Transportation Assistance Policyapplies for the duration of the New VehicleLimited Warranty. The policy applies to all2018 model-year Toyotas sold andserviced by authorized Toyota dealershipsin the mainland United States and Alaska.

WHAT IS COVERED ANDHOW LONGBasic Warranty

This warranty covers repairs andadjustments needed to correct defects inmaterials or workmanship of any partsupplied by Toyota, subject to theexceptions indicated under “What Is NotCovered” on pages 14-15.

Coverage is for 36 months or36,000 miles, whichever occurs first, withthe exception of wheel alignment andwheel balancing, which are covered for12 months or 12,000 miles, whicheveroccurs first.

Powertrain Warranty

This warranty covers repairs needed tocorrect defects in materials orworkmanship of any component listedbelow and in the next column andsupplied by Toyota, subject to theexceptions indicated under “What Is NotCovered” on pages 14-15.

Coverage is for 60 months or60,000 miles, whichever occurs first.

Engine

Cylinder block and head and all internalparts, timing gears and gaskets, timingchain/belt and cover, flywheel, valvecovers, oil pan, oil pump, engine mounts,turbocharger housing and all internalparts, supercharger housing and allinternal parts, engine control computer,water pump, fuel pump, seals and gaskets.

Transmission and Transaxle

Case and all internal parts, torqueconverter, clutch cover, transmissionmounts, transfer case and all internalparts, engine control computer, seals andgaskets.

Front-Wheel-Drive System

Final drive housing and all internal parts,axle shafts, drive shafts, constant velocityjoints, front hub and bearings, seals andgaskets.

Rear-Wheel-Drive System

Axle housing and all internal parts,propeller shafts, U-joints, axle shafts, driveshafts, bearings, supports, seals andgaskets.

Restraint Systems Warranty

This warranty covers repairs needed tocorrect defects in materials orworkmanship of any seatbelt or air bagsystem supplied by Toyota, subject to theexceptions indicated under “What Is NotCovered” on pages 14-15.

Coverage is for 60 months or60,000 miles, whichever occurs first.

For vehicles sold and registered in thestate of Kansas, the warranty for seatbeltsand related components is 10 years,regardless of mileage.

Corrosion Perforation Warranty

This warranty covers repair or replacementof any original body panel that developsperforation from corrosion (rust-through),subject to the exceptions indicated under“What Is Not Covered” on pages 14-15.

Coverage is for 60 months, regardless ofmileage.

For information on how to protect yourvehicle from corrosion, refer to sectionsrelated to maintenance and care in theOwner’s Manual.

Towing

When your vehicle is inoperable due tofailure of a warranted part, towing serviceto the nearest authorized Toyota dealershipis covered.

WHAT IS NOT COVEREDThis warranty does not cover damage orfailures resulting directly or indirectly fromany of the following:

• Fire, accidents or theft

• Abuse or negligence

• Misuse — for example, racing oroverloading

• Improper repairs

• Alteration or tampering, includinginstallation of non-Genuine ToyotaAccessories

• Lack of or improper maintenance,including use of fluids and fuel otherthan those specified in the Owner’sManual

• Installation of non-Genuine Toyota Parts

• Airborne chemicals, tree sap, roaddebris (including stone chips), rail dust,salt, hail, floods, wind storms, lightningand other environmental conditions

• Water contamination

This warranty also does not cover thefollowing:

Tires

Tires are covered by a separate warrantyprovided by the tire manufacturer. Seepage 29.

Normal Wear and Tear

Noise, vibration, cosmetic conditions andother deterioration caused by normal wearand tear.

WHAT IS COVERED ANDHOW LONGEmission Defect Warranty

Toyota warrants that your vehicle:

• Was designed, built and equipped toconform at the time of sale withapplicable federal emissions standards.

• Is free from defects in materials andworkmanship that may cause thevehicle to fail to meet these standards.

Federal regulations require that thiswarranty be in effect for two years or24,000 miles from the vehicle’s in-servicedate, whichever occurs first. However,under the terms of the Basic Warranty,Toyota provides coverage of three years or36,000 miles, whichever occurs first.Specific components may have longercoverage under the terms of thePowertrain Warranty. Additionally,components marked “8/80” in the partslist on pages 18-19 have coverage of eightyears or 80,000 miles, whichever occursfirst.

Emission Performance Warranty

Some states and localities haveestablished vehicle inspection andmaintenance (I/M) programs to encourageproper vehicle maintenance. If anEPA-approved I/M program is in force inyour area, you are eligible for EmissionPerformance Warranty coverage.

Under the terms of the EmissionPerformance Warranty and federalregulations, Toyota will make all necessaryrepairs if both of the following occur:

• Your vehicle fails to meet applicableemissions standards as determined byan EPA-approved emissions test.

• This failure results or will result insome penalty to you — such as a fineor denial of the right to use yourvehicle — under local, state or federallaw.

This warranty is in effect for two years or24,000 miles from the vehicle’s in-servicedate, whichever occurs first. Additionally,components marked �8/80� in the partslist on pages 18-19 have coverage of eightyears or 80,000 miles, whichever occursfirst.

YOUR WARRANTY RIGHTSAND OBLIGATIONSThe California Air Resources Board (CARB)and Toyota are pleased to explain theemission control system warranty for your2018 vehicle. In California, new motorvehicles must be designed, built andequipped to meet the state’s stringentanti-smog standards. CARB regulationsrequire that Toyota must warrant theemission control system on your vehiclefor the time periods indicated on the nextpage, provided there has been no abuse,neglect or improper maintenance of yourvehicle.

Your emission control system may includeparts such as the fuel injection system,ignition system, catalytic converter andengine computer. Also included may behoses, belts, connectors and otheremissions-related assemblies.

Where a warrantable condition exists,Toyota will repair your vehicle at no costto you, including diagnosis, parts andlabor.

MANUFACTURER’SWARRANTY COVERAGE1) For three years or 50,000 miles,

whichever occurs first:

– If your vehicle fails a smog-checktest, all necessary repairs andadjustments will be made by Toyotato ensure that your vehicle passesthe test. This is your EmissionControl System PERFORMANCEWARRANTY.

– If an emissions-related part listed onpages 18-19 is defective, the part willbe repaired or replaced by Toyota.This is your SHORT-TERM EmissionControl System DEFECT WARRANTY.Specific components may havelonger coverage under the terms ofthe Powertrain Warranty.

2) For seven years or 70,000 miles,whichever occurs first:

– If an emissions-related part listed onpage 25 is defective, the part will berepaired or replaced by Toyota. Thisis your LONG-TERM EmissionControl System DEFECT WARRANTY.

OWNER’S WARRANTYRESPONSIBILITIESYou are responsible for performance ofthe required maintenance indicated in theOwner’s Manual and this booklet. Toyotarecommends that you retain all receiptscovering maintenance on your vehicle, butToyota cannot deny warranty coveragesolely for the lack of receipts or yourfailure to ensure the performance of allscheduled maintenance.

You are responsible for presenting yourvehicle to a Toyota dealership as soon asa problem exists. The warranty repairsshould be completed in a reasonableamount of time, not to exceed 30 days.

You should also be aware that Toyota maydeny you warranty coverage if your vehicleor a part has failed due to abuse, neglect,improper maintenance or unapprovedmodifications.

EMERGENCY REPAIRSIf your vehicle is inoperable or unsafe todrive and there is no Toyota dealershipreasonably available to make repairs, youmay perform the repairs yourself or havethem performed by another automotiveservice provider. Toyota will reimburse youfor any of the repairs that are covered bywarranty. To receive reimbursement,present to an authorized Toyota dealershipyour paid repair invoices and any partsthat were removed from the vehicle. Youwill be reimbursed for warranted parts atthe manufacturer’s suggested retail priceand warranted labor at a geographicallyappropriate hourly rate multiplied byToyota’s recommended time allowance forthe repair.

If your vehicle requires emergency repair,Toyota assumes no liability for subsequentfailures caused by improper repairs or theuse of non-Genuine Toyota Parts unlessyou have the vehicle properly repaired in atimely manner. To ensure that warrantycoverage remains intact, have your vehicleinspected by an authorized Toyotadealership as soon as possible after anemergency repair.

IMPORTANT MAINTENANCEINFORMATIONIt is especially important to bothroutinely check your vehicle’s engine oillevel (once a month) and regularlyreplace the engine oil and oil filter (seethe Maintenance Log section of thisbooklet to determine how often youshould change your vehicle’s oil andfilter). Failure to do so can cause oilstarvation and or oil gelling, which canresult in severe damage to your vehicleand require costly repairs that are notcovered by the New Vehicle LimitedWarranty.

Miles or Months?

Toyota recommends obtaining scheduledmaintenance for your vehicle every5,000 miles or six months, whichevercomes first.

For example:

• If you drive 5,000 miles in less than sixmonths, you should obtain maintenanceat 5,000 miles - don’t wait until sixmonths.

• If at six months you have driven lessthan 5,000 miles, you should obtainmaintenance at six months - don’t waituntil 5,000 miles.

Be sure to keep an eye on your mileage sothat you obtain maintenance whenrecommended. If you are a low-mileagedriver, mark your calendar to remindyourself to obtain maintenance every sixmonths.

Automatic Transmission Fluid orManual Transmission Oil

Inspect or replace at specified intervals.When performing inspections, check eachcomponent for signs of leakage. If youdiscover any leakage, have it repaired by aqualified technician immediately.

Ball Joints and Dust Covers

Check the suspension and steering linkageball joints for looseness and damage.Check all dust covers for deterioration anddamage. Replace any deteriorated ordamaged parts. A qualified technicianshould perform these operations.

Brake Lines and Hoses

Visually inspect for proper installation.Check for chafing, cracks, deteriorationand signs of leakage. Replace anydeteriorated or damaged parts. A qualifiedtechnician should perform theseoperations.

Brake Linings/Drums and BrakePads/Discs

Check the brake linings (shoes) anddrums for scoring, burning, fluid leakage,broken parts and excessive wear. Checkthe pads for excessive wear and the discsfor runout, excessive wear and fluidleakage. Replace any deteriorated ordamaged parts. A qualified technicianshould perform these operations.

Cabin Air Filter

Replace at specified intervals. Driving inheavy traffic, on dirt roads or in urban,desert or dusty areas may shorten filter’slife. More frequent replacement may benecessary.

Drive Belts

Inspect for cracks, excessive wear andoiliness. Check the belt tension and adjustif necessary. Replace the belts if they aredamaged.

Drive Shaft Boots

Check the drive shaft boots and clampsfor cracks, deterioration and damage.Replace any deteriorated or damaged partsand, if necessary, repack the grease. Aqualified technician should perform theseoperations.

Driver’s Floor Mat• Only use the driver’s floor mat

designed specifically for the model andmodel year of your vehicle.

• Always properly secure the driver’sfloor mat using the retaining hooks.

• Never install another floor mat on topof the existing driver’s floor mat.

• Never install the driver’s floor matupside down.

Engine Air Filter

Inspect or replace at specified intervals.When performing inspections, check fordamage, excessive wear and oiliness, andreplace if necessary.

Engine Coolant

Drain the cooling system and refill with anethylene-glycol type coolant. Inspect hosesand connections for corrosion and leaks.Tighten connections and replace partswhen necessary. A qualified technicianshould perform these operations. (Forfurther details, refer to “Radiator,Condenser and Hoses” in the“Maintenance and Care” section of theOwner’s Manual).

Your Toyota is equipped with GenuineToyota Super Long-Life Coolant. Thereplacement intervals for engine coolantrecommended in this booklet are basedon replacement with Genuine ToyotaSuper Long-Life Coolant or similarhigh-quality non-silicate, non-amine,non-borate ethylene-glycol coolant withlong-life hybrid organic acid technology(i.e., a combination of low phosphatesand organic acids). If another type ofethylene-glycol coolant is used,replacement intervals may be different.

Engine Oil and Oil Filter

Replace the oil filter and drain and refillthe engine oil at specified intervals. Forrecommended oil grade and viscosity,refer to the Owner’s Manual.

Engine Valve Clearance

Inspect for tappet noise and enginevibration and adjust if necessary. Aqualified technician should perform thisoperation.

Exhaust Pipes and Mountings

Visually inspect the exhaust pipes, mufflerand hangers for cracks, deterioration anddamage. Start the engine and listencarefully for any exhaust gas leakage.Tighten connections or replace parts asnecessary.

Fuel Lines and Connections,Fuel Tank Band and Fuel TankVapor Vent System Hoses

Visually inspect for corrosion, damage,cracks, and loose or leaking connections.Tighten connections or replace parts asnecessary.

Fuel Tank Cap Gasket

Visually inspect for cracks, deteriorationand damage and replace if necessary.

Nuts and Bolts on Chassis andBody

Re-tighten the seat-mounting bolts andfront/rear suspension member retainingbolts to specified torque.

Radiator and Condenser

Inspect for debris, corrosion and signs ofdamage. Have any problem repairedimmediately by a qualified technician.

Spark Plugs

Replace at specified intervals. Install newplugs of the same type as originallyequipped. A qualified technician shouldperform this operation.

Steering Gear

Inspect for signs of leakage. If youdiscover any leakage, have it repairedimmediately by a qualified technician.

Steering Linkage and Boots

With the vehicle stopped, check forexcessive freeplay in the steering wheel.Inspect the linkage for bending anddamage and the dust boots fordeterioration, cracks and damage. Replaceany damaged parts. A qualified technicianshould perform these operations.

Tire Rotation

Tires should be rotated according to theinstructions in the Owner’s Manual. Whenrotating tires, check for damage anduneven wear. Replace if necessary.

Wiper Blades

The wiper blades should not show anysigns of cracking, splitting, wear,contamination or deformation. The wiperblades should clear the windshield withoutstreaking or skipping.
